If you’re like me and have struggled at times to get into a Picross-style game, then “Picbox” may be for you. It has the puzzling gameplay you’re looking for, but with a solid tutorial that makes it easy to get into. If you’re into this style of game (or thought you might want to be, if you could ever figure it out), then “Picbox” and its 100 levels are a perfect entry point to the genre. There are even leaderboards, which is a neat addition for a puzzle game. Lots of value here for 80 Microsoft Points.
Here’s what the developer (Stinky Badger Games) has to say about the game:
“Create pixelated pictures from the number clues in this addictive puzzle game! Featuring 100 puzzles, 28 awardments, a tutorial video to get you started, and many hours of puzzling fun!”
